Output c766d8130c06a0b805c73c2199e7a14d3af2823d4b84a9c521a48ee18a268942:0

value
14756284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a703211420eb91645cb40bf3971f087055247c OP_EQUAL
address
MJ5XJwFFhDZ8roRvkkxDRCi81kemFtAY9E
transaction
c766d8130c06a0b805c73c2199e7a14d3af2823d4b84a9c521a48ee18a268942
spent
true